The Power of SEO Optimised Content
In the digital age, creating high-quality content is essential for businesses looking to enhance their online presence. However, simply producing great content is not enough; it must also be optimised for search engines to ensure maximum visibility and reach. This is where SEO optimised content comes into play.
SEO, or Search Engine Optimisation, is the practice of enhancing a website’s visibility on search engine results pages. By incorporating relevant keywords, meta tags, and other SEO best practices into your content, you can improve your website’s ranking and attract more organic traffic.
SEO optimised content not only helps your website rank higher in search engine results but also enhances user experience. By providing valuable and relevant information to your audience, you can increase engagement and encourage users to spend more time on your site.
When creating SEO optimised content, it’s important to conduct keyword research to identify the terms and phrases your target audience is searching for. By strategically integrating these keywords into your content, you can improve its relevance and make it more likely to appear in search results.
Additionally, structuring your content with headings, subheadings, and bullet points can make it easier for both users and search engines to understand its key points. Including internal links to other pages on your website can also improve navigation and encourage users to explore further.
In conclusion, SEO optimised content is a powerful tool for improving your website’s visibility and attracting more organic traffic. By incorporating SEO best practices into your content creation strategy, you can enhance user experience, increase engagement, and ultimately drive business growth.

What is SEO optimized and conversion optimized content?
SEO optimized content and conversion optimized content serve distinct yet interconnected purposes in the realm of digital marketing. SEO optimized content focuses on enhancing a website’s visibility on search engine results pages by incorporating relevant keywords, meta tags, and other SEO best practices. On the other hand, conversion optimized content is tailored to drive specific actions from visitors, such as making a purchase or filling out a contact form. While SEO optimization aims to attract organic traffic and improve rankings, conversion optimization aims to maximise the likelihood of visitors taking desired actions once they land on a webpage. By combining both SEO and conversion optimization strategies, businesses can create content that not only attracts more visitors but also converts them into valuable leads or customers.

How do you check if content is SEO optimized?
To determine if content is SEO optimised, several key factors should be considered. Firstly, conducting a thorough keyword analysis to ensure relevant keywords are strategically incorporated throughout the content is essential. Checking for proper keyword placement in titles, headings, meta tags, and body text can indicate SEO optimisation. Additionally, evaluating the content’s readability, structure, and use of internal and external links can provide insights into its SEO effectiveness. Utilising online tools such as SEO plugins or analyzers to assess factors like keyword density, meta descriptions, and overall readability can further confirm if content is optimised for search engines. Regular monitoring of search engine rankings and organic traffic generated by the content can also help gauge its SEO performance over time.
